Is je website uit de lucht, maar heb je geen toegang tot de backend om deze te repareren? Deze handleiding helpt je de oorzaken van de websiteproblemen te achterhalen, zodat je de juiste stappen kunt nemen om ze op te lossen.
De meest voorkomende WP-fouten waardoor je niet kunt inloggen:
- Witte pagina
- "500 Internal Server Error"
- "Critical Server Error"
- "Database Connection", "404, Page not found" & "403, Forbidden"
Interpretatie van verschillende foutcodes en oplossingen
- Een foutcode interpreteren
- De foutcode bevat het woord "plugin"
- De foutcode bevat het woord "theme"
- De foutcode bevat "wp-admin" of "wp-includes"
Opmerking: Als het probleem een verkeerd wachtwoord of gebruikersnaam is, volg dan deze aparte handleiding en wijzig de WordPress inloggegevens.
Witte pagina
Het kan behoorlijk vervelend zijn met deze foutmelding te maken te krijgen, omdat je geen toegang hebt tot WordPress en er geen foutmeldingen zijn om verder mee te werken.
Wat je ziet: Letterlijk een witte pagina zonder inhoud.
Mogelijke oorzaak: De website kan een wit scherm weergeven nadat de geheugenlimiet is bereikt.
Wat te doen: Probeer eerst de browsercache te legen. Als er niets verandert, volg dan de onderstaande stappen.
- Debugging inschakelen.
- Wacht een paar minuten en ververs de pagina.
- Interpreteer de code en ontdek hoe je een fout kunt herstellen.
Opmerking: Als er nog geen foutcode is verschenen, kan dit met PHP te maken hebben. Activeer PHP foutmeldingen, wacht 20 minuten tot er een fout verschijnt. Ga verder met het interpreteren van de code.
"500 Internal Server Error"
Net als een hele witte pagina, geeft deze algemene foutmelding nog geen waardevolle informatie. Door de onderstaande stappen te volgen, krijg je een specifiekere foutmelding die je kan helpen te begrijpen wat de oorzaak van het probleem is.
Wat je ziet: Een voornamelijk witte pagina met een uitleg over een "Interne server".
Mogelijke oorzaken: Verkeerd benoemde .htaccess bestanden, PHP geheugenlimieten, verouderde WordPress plugins en thema's.
Wat te doen: Probeer eerst de browsercache te legen. Als er niets verandert, volg dan de onderstaande stappen.
- Debugging inschakelen.
- Wacht een paar minuten en ververs de pagina.
- Interpreteer de code en ontdek hoe je een fout kunt herstellen.
Opmerking: Als er nog geen foutcode is verschenen, kan dit met PHP te maken hebben. Activeer PHP foutmeldingen, wacht 20 minuten tot er een fout verschijnt. Ga verder met het interpreteren van de code.
"Critical Server Error"
Laat je niet afschrikken door het woord "critical". Je hoeft je geen zorgen te maken dat je website kapot is. Deze handleiding kan je helpen het probleem op te lossen en weer toegang te krijgen tot de WP Admin. Het helpt altijd als je je nog herinnert wat je laatste actie was. Misschien is er een plugin verwijderd of geïnstalleerd? Misschien is de PHP-versie gewijzigd?
Wat je ziet: Een overwegend grijze pagina met een kader waarin staat dat er "een kritieke fout op de website is opgetreden".
Mogelijke oorzaak: Vaak zorgen PHP-problemen en slecht werkende plugins, thema's of scripts ervoor dat WordPress crasht.
Wat te doen: Probeer eerst de browsercache te legen. Als er niets verandert, volg dan de onderstaande stappen.
- Debugging inschakelen.
- Wacht een paar minuten en ververs de pagina.
- Interpreteer de code en ontdek hoe je een fout kunt herstellen.
Opmerking: Als er nog geen foutcode is verschenen, kan dit met PHP te maken hebben. Controleer de PHP-versie en activeer PHP foutmeldingen. Na 20 minuten moet er een foutmelding zijn die je verder kunt interpreteren.
"Database Connection Error", "404-Page not found" & "403-Forbidden"
"Error Establishing a Database Connection WordPress"
- Wat te doen: WordPress database connectiegegevens bijwerken
"403, Forbidden Error"
- Wat te doen: (Stap-voor-stap handleiding wordt binnenkort toegevoegd)
- Ga naar File Manager
- Open de map wp-admin.
- Zoek het .htaccess bestand.
- Verwijder deze en bevestig de verwijdering van het bestand twee keer.
- Start de 1-click installatie opnieuw door de domeinnaam in de browser in te typen.
"404, Page not found."
- Wat te doen: 404-fouten door permalinks oplossen in WordPress
Een foutcode interpreteren
Een foutcode kan in eerste instantie overweldigend lijken, maar met deze eenvoudige truc kun je snel vaststellen waar het om gaat en de juiste stappen ondernemen om het probleem op te lossen. Hier is de truc:
Druk op Ctrl+F (of Cmd+F) op het toetsenbord en zoek naar de termen "plugins" of "themes".
De foutcode bevat het woord "plugin"
De oorzaak van het probleem is de plugin die na /plugins/ wordt vermeld.
....../wp-content/plugins/[plugin_name]
Wat je ziet:
Voordat je verder gaat, is het erg belangrijk om een back-up van de webruimte en database te maken.
Wat te doen:
- Schakel al je plugins uit de database uit.
- Je zou nu weer toegang tot WP Admin moeten hebben.
- Zorg ervoor dat je in WP Admin alles bijwerkt (alle plugins, thema's en de WP-versie).
- Heractiveer de plugins één voor één.
- (optioneel) Als een plugin van derden niet kan worden bijgewerkt, zal het fouten blijven veroorzaken. Verwijder deze van de webruimte of neem contact op met de ontwikkelaar van de plugin.
Tip: We hebben een hele lijst met plugins verzameld die we afraden om te gebruiken. Bekijk onze lijst met niet aanbevolen WordPress plugins.
De foutcode bevat het woord "theme"
De oorzaak van het probleem is het thema dat na /themes/ wordt vermeld.
....../wp-content/themes/[theme name]
Wat je ziet:
Voordat je verder gaat, is het erg belangrijk om een back-up van de webruimte en database te maken.
Wat te doen:
- Verander het WordPress thema in een standaard thema vanuit de database.
- Je zou nu weer toegang tot WP Admin moeten hebben.
- Zorg ervoor dat je in WP Admin alles bijwerkt (alle plugins, thema's en de WP-versie).
- (optioneel) Als een thema van derden niet kan worden bijgewerkt, zal het fouten blijven veroorzaken. Verwijder deze van de webruimte of neem contact op met de ontwikkelaar van het thema.
De foutcode bevat "wp-admin" of "wp-includes"
Als de foutmelding noch /wp-content/ noch /plugins/ of /themes/ bevat, heeft het probleem hoogstwaarschijnlijk te maken met de WordPress kernbestanden en kan dit worden opgelost door een handmatige update.
Wat je ziet:
Voordat je verder gaat, is het erg belangrijk om een back-up van de webruimte en database te maken.
- Controleer nogmaals of de back-ups zijn gelukt.
- WordPress handmatig updaten.
- Je zou nu weer toegang tot WP Admin moeten hebben.
Tip: Lees meer over onze tips over hoe je de beveiliging van een WordPress site kunt verbeteren .
Gerelateerde artikelen: